Assessment of Disease Activity in Ulcerative Colitis by Faecal Calprotectin, a Novel Granulocyte Marker Protein

Abstract: This study comprised 62 outpatients with ulcerative colitis who underwent 64 colonoscopies. The disease activity was evaluated according to endoscopic and histological criteria. The results revealed a significant correlation between both the endoscopic as well as the histological gradings of disease activity and faecal calprotectin. The median faecal calprotectin levels in the control group (6 mg/l) and in the patients with no or low disease activity (11.5 mg/l) were significantly different (p < 0.0001). The m… Show more

“…Increased calprotectin concentrations that correlated with the endoscopic-histological grading of intestinal inflammation were detected in adults and children with inflammatory bowel diseases (IBD). [3][4][5] Faecal concentrations of calprotectin were higher in subjects with colorectal carcinoma and in those on short-term anti-inflammatory treatment than in healthy controls. 6,7 In addition, the combination of faecal calprotectin, intestinal permeability test and positive Rome I criteria reliably discriminated between patients with organic and nonorganic intestinal diseases.…”
